Outline of Final Research Achievements

To determine the amount of calcium salt of MDP (MDP-Ca salt) developed during the adhesive application period to enamel or dentin, we designed a series of experimental MDP-based one-step adhesives with different amounts of MDP (EX adhesive). The effect of the concentration of MDP added in the EX adhesive on the types of the molecular species of MDP-Ca salts and their production amounts were examined. The enamel predominantly yielded mono-calcium salts of the MDP monomer and dimer, but in contrast, the dentin yielded di-calcium salts of the MDP monomer and dimer along with them. The amounts of MDP-Ca salt developed enamel and dentin increased with an increase in the amount of MDP added.
